I recently adopted a new piggy to keep my other guinea pig, Lola, some company. I've noticed that the new (female) guinea pig's genitals are a lot larger and more pronounced than Lola's, and I was wondering if this is a normal thing that happens when one pig is trying to display dominance over the other.I know a female's genitals swell when they are in heat, but the new pig has had swelling for about a week so I'm not sure if it's that.

Any help would be appreciated! I'm a new cavy owner so every little thing worries me, so I would just like to know whether a vet trip would be a good idea right now or sot.

Guinea pig genitals are VERY hard to figure out. There have been many times where pet stores, rescues and EVEN vets have not been able to sex a guinea pig. Could you post a pic here of the piggies genitals? Have you tried the "push test" to look for a penis. Here are some resources for sexing a GP...

It is possible that the swollen "vulva" is actually testicles as GPs testicles don't always hang down like other species...
 
I have never noticed any type of swollen genitals on my females even when in heat. If it's that noticable I would think that you may have a missexed piggie. Sounds like the odds of it being a male are pretty high.
 
Is your new pig bigger and older than your original one?

Is your new pig eating and drinking normally? Has she lost any weight? Any squeaking or pain upon pooping or peeing? Sometimes a female guinea pig with a bladder stone at the opening will have swollen genitals.
 
I have a pig with what I would call swollen gentials.

She is 2-3, spayed and currently being treated for a UTI. It is kind of puffed out and I might say slightly protruding.

It has been like this for a while and has been bothering me, I mean the difference between the two same aged/conditioned females. Now that you have brought up this thread it has made me want to discuss this with my vet.

I realize this does not help any but just to let you know you may not be just seeing things.
 
I took my guinea pig to the vet, she flushed the area in case she had a crystal sitting just inside in that area. The vet thought that this protrusion was normal and possibly just an anatomical difference between different guinea pigs.
